To test this, can we just use 'objdump'. The hex codes should be identical; there is only one encoding. It should produce the same binaries. No need to run test-suites, etc.
yes, I should be trivial to test (and find the trivial problem, with the patch I attached). I am wondering though if all version of gas accept the suffix notation... any idea?
